PCC Welcomes Students to Fall Term on Aug. 26

by Pasadena Independent
share with

Pasadena City College’s 2013 fall semester will begin Monday, Aug. 26 and end Dec. 15.
More than 27,000 students are expected to attend the first day of fall semester. PCC will offer 2,769 class sections in the morning, afternoon and evening for the convenience of the students. Though classes are filling up quickly, there are ample sections available for those not yet enrolled.
Academic and Career and Technical Education classes are offered on the main PCC campus and at the Community Education Center, located at 3035 E. Foothill Blvd in Pasadena. The college offers more than 60 academic areas and issues certificates in more than 70 Career and Technical Education disciplines.
Students may apply and register online, check the status of their enrollment, and learn the availability of classes via the Internet by accessing www.pasadena.edu and then logging into LancerPoint. PCC staff is available to answer any questions.
